Oh, dude, you're hitting me with some math lingo! So, the quotient of c and nine is c/9, and if you decrease that by 3, you just subtract 3 from it. So, the expression would be (c/9) - 3. Voilà! Math made easy... kind of.

The quotient of c divided by d is called a fraction. In mathematical terms, it is represented as c/d. This fraction represents the result of dividing c by d. The numerator (c) is divided by the denominator (d) to obtain the quotient.

The expression for the quotient of 45 and the sum of c and 17 is 45 / (c + 17). This expression represents the result of dividing 45 by the sum of c and 17. To simplify this expression further, you would need a specific value for c to calculate the exact quotient.
